### 2.2 `backend/app/sim/` — 本地模拟
|
||||
|
||||
```text
|
||||
sim/
|
||||
├── matcher.py # 撮合:永续市价;期权吃买卖一;滑点=1×f;双边手续费
|
||||
├── ledger.py # 虚拟资金、占用、流水
|
||||
├── liquidity.py # 买一深度是否覆盖 2 ETH
|
||||
└── pricing.py # 成交价公式(含 f)
|
||||
```
|
||||
|
||||
成交价口径(与开发方案一致):
|
||||
|
||||
| 腿 | 动作 | 基准 | 成交价 |
|
||||
|----|------|------|--------|
|
||||
| 永续 | 开多 / 平空 | 卖一 | 基准 × (1+f) |
|
||||
| 永续 | 开空 / 平多 | 买一 | 基准 × (1-f) |
|
||||
| 期权 | 买入 | 卖一 | 基准 × (1+f) |
|
||||
| 期权 | 卖出 | 买一 | 基准 × (1-f) |
|
||||
|
||||
另扣:`手续费 = 名义 × f`。
|
||||
|
||||
### 2.3 `backend/app/strategy/` — 自动对冲
|
||||
|
||||
```text
|
||||
strategy/
|
||||
├── clock.py # 业务窗:D 16:00~D+1 08:00;次数≤3
|
||||
├── signal.py # Call 卖一 vs Put 卖一 → 方向
|
||||
├── exits.py # 权利金覆盖 / 30 点
|
||||
├── sizing.py # 永续 1 ETH、期权 2 ETH(写死)
|
||||
├── group.py # 组 ID:G-YYYYMMDD-NN
|
||||
└── engine.py # 状态机:空仓→开仓→盯盘→全平→下一组
|
||||
```
|
||||
|
||||
状态机要点:
|
||||
|
||||
- 同时最多 1 组。
|
||||
- 平完才允许下一组;达 3 次或过 08:00 则停开。
|
||||
- 每组锁定 `initial_premium`。
|
||||
